#ifndef AT_BLE_COMMON_H_
#define AT_BLE_COMMON_H_
//#if (CONFIG_BLE_5_X || CONFIG_BTDM_5_2)
#include "at_common.h"
/// reference common_bt_defines.h
#define ADV_INTERVAL_MIN 0x0020 //(20 ms)
#define ADV_INTERVAL_MAX 0x4000 //(10.24 sec)
#define CON_INTERVAL_MIN 0x0006 //(7.5 msec)
#define CON_INTERVAL_MAX 0x0C80 //(4 sec)
/// Supervision TO (N*10ms) (chapter 2.E.7.8.12)
#define CON_SUP_TO_MIN 0x000A //(100 msec)
#define CON_SUP_TO_MAX 0x0C80 //(32 sec)
/// Scanning interval (in 625us slot) (chapter 2.E.7.8.10)
#define SCAN_INTERVAL_MIN 0x0004 //(2.5 ms)
#define SCAN_INTERVAL_MAX 0x4000 //(10.24 sec)
#define SCAN_INTERVAL_DFT 0x0010 //(10 ms)
/// Scanning window (in 625us slot) (chapter 2.E.7.8.10)
#define SCAN_WINDOW_MIN 0x0004 //(2.5 ms)
#define SCAN_WINDOW_MAX 0x4000 //(10.24 sec)
#define SCAN_WINDOW_DFT 0x0010 //(10 ms)
/// Connection latency (N*cnx evt) (chapter 2.E.7.8.12)
#define CON_LATENCY_MIN 0x0000
#define CON_LATENCY_MAX 0x01F3 // (499)
#define UNKNOW_ACT_IDX 0xFFU
#define AT_BLE_MAX_ACTV bk_ble_get_max_actv_idx_count()
#define AT_BLE_MAX_CONN bk_ble_get_max_conn_idx_count()
